A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Projekte [UPDATED] l33track - MP3 Player / DJ Software
Thema durchsuchen
Ansicht
Themen-Optionen

[UPDATED] l33track - MP3 Player / DJ Software

Ein Thema von kurtm1 · begonnen am 14. Aug 2005 · letzter Beitrag vom 14. Dez 2005
Antwort Antwort
Seite 4 von 4   « Erste     234   
kurtm1
Registriert seit: 12. Dez 2003
Ich bin gerade dabei einen MP3 Player zu programmieren, der zusätzlich einige DJ Funktion beinhaltet.

Das Programm ist eigentlich selbsterklärend, daher gibt es hier keine Anleitung, bei etwaigen Fragen bin ich jedoch natürlich hier um sie zu beantworten.

Ich bitte für alle die das Programm getestet haben, dass sie mir sagen, was sie gut finden/schlecht finden/was noch fehlt, etc. [Vorallem im Bereich der DJ Funktionen]

danke!

//EDIT: Screenshot:
//EDIT2: Ich wurde darauf aufmerksam gemacht, dass es nicht wünschenswert ist, dass l33track beim ersten Start die System/AudioLautstärken auf 95% setzt. Dass dies wirklich Boxenbeschädigen kann, weil der Benutzer nicht mit der geänderten Lautstärke rechnet, habe ich beim coden wirklich nicht bedacht, wird aber in der nächsten Version geändert. Hier bitte Vorsicht!!
Angehängte Dateien
Dateityp: zip l33track_607.zip (424,1 KB, 147x aufgerufen)
 
kurtm1
 
#31
  Alt 23. Okt 2005, 16:33
So ich bin derzeit eben dabei was neues zu schaffen, und bitte mal um Rückmeldungen:

Die folgende Datei enthält die Media Library wie sie dann auch später verwendet werden soll. Weiters lege ich große Wert auf transparenz für den User, daher werden keine Registrierungsschlüsseln, oder sonstiges was den PC versaut angelegt.
Die Einstellungen werden lediglich in *.txt Files gespeichert (in dem Verzeichnis wo die Programm exe liegt, daher bitte vor dem Öffnen die Datei in einen Ordner geben).

JA ich bitte mal um Rückmeldung, was man im Bezug auf die MediaLib noch ändern/hinzufügen könnte.

Zur Bedienung: Die ganze Lib wird eigentlich mit dem PopUP Menü bedient, das aufgeht wenn man auf den Registerkartenbereich klickt (mit der rechten Maustaste).
Angehängte Dateien
Dateityp: zip l33track_medialibrary_131.zip (228,0 KB, 27x aufgerufen)
  Mit Zitat antworten Zitat
Benutzerbild von Cyberbob
Cyberbob

 
Delphi XE7 Architect
 
#32
  Alt 23. Okt 2005, 19:22
Hi,

wenn ich ein Lied in der Liste auswähle und dann obn auf Play drücke, wird immer dasnächste lied in der Liste abgespielt. Wenn ich nur ein Lied in der Liste hab, bekomme ich eine Fehlermeldung das der Listenindex(1) überschritten wurde.
Christian
  Mit Zitat antworten Zitat
kurtm1
 
#33
  Alt 23. Okt 2005, 20:13
Zitat von Cyberbob:
Hi,

wenn ich ein Lied in der Liste auswähle und dann obn auf Play drücke, wird immer dasnächste lied in der Liste abgespielt. Wenn ich nur ein Lied in der Liste hab, bekomme ich eine Fehlermeldung das der Listenindex(1) überschritten wurde.
ja das sind die Bugs der letzten/alten Version, die jedoch ganz neu entstehen wird

würde mich freuen, wenn ich zu der medialibrary rückmeldungen bekommen würde
  Mit Zitat antworten Zitat
Benutzerbild von Cyberbob
Cyberbob

 
Delphi XE7 Architect
 
#34
  Alt 23. Okt 2005, 20:53
Klar, kein Problem. Auf anhieb hab ich jetzt mal geschaut, was man noch ergänzen könnte, währe:

Unterscheidung von Groß- Kleinschreibung im Filter
Umschaltung zwischen Dateinamen und MP3-Tags in der Track-Liste
Das man einstellen kann, ob der Filter-Text am Anfanf, in der Mitte oder am Ende zu suchen ist
Mit Ctrl+A sollte man auch die Ganze Liste markieren können
Man sollte Rigisterkarten auch Verschieben können
Christian
  Mit Zitat antworten Zitat
kurtm1
 
#35
  Alt 23. Okt 2005, 21:14
Zitat von Cyberbob:
Auf anhieb hab ich jetzt mal geschaut, was man noch ergänzen könnte, währe:

Unterscheidung von Groß- Kleinschreibung im Filter
Umschaltung zwischen Dateinamen und MP3-Tags in der Track-Liste
Das man einstellen kann, ob der Filter-Text am Anfanf, in der Mitte oder am Ende zu suchen ist
Mit Ctrl+A sollte man auch die Ganze Liste markieren können
Man sollte Rigisterkarten auch Verschieben können
Groß/Kleinschreibung wird eigentlich nicht benützt, sprich ich mache alles kleingeschrieben, wenn man in das Suchfeld Großbuchstaben eingibt, werden diese automatisch auf kleine convertiert, habe nur vergessen dies dann auch im Feld so anzuzeigen, thx für den Tipp

Den Suchtext in der Mitte, etc. zu suchen hat irgendwie keinen Sinn finde ich

Strg+A mit dem kann man alle Songs in einer Registerkarte markieren, das funzt eh schon

Das mit dem verschieben werd ich mir anschauen

thx für deine anregungen
  Mit Zitat antworten Zitat
Benutzerbild von Cyberbob
Cyberbob

 
Delphi XE7 Architect
 
#36
  Alt 23. Okt 2005, 21:22
Das Markieren geht nur bis zu einer gewissen menge an Elementen, wird dieses Menge überschritten, wird nur ein Element markiert.
Wenn ich alle Gruppen lösche und das Programm neu Starte, erhalte ich die Fehlermeldung "Registerindex außerhalb des gültigen Bereichs". (Die Datei l-mg.txt ist Leer und wird nicht gelöscht)
Christian
  Mit Zitat antworten Zitat
kurtm1
 
#37
  Alt 23. Okt 2005, 21:33
Zitat von Cyberbob:
Das Markieren geht nur bis zu einer gewissen menge an Elementen, wird dieses Menge überschritten, wird nur ein Element markiert.
Wenn ich alle Gruppen lösche und das Programm neu Starte, erhalte ich die Fehlermeldung "Registerindex außerhalb des gültigen Bereichs". (Die Datei l-mg.txt ist Leer und wird nicht gelöscht)
zu 1.: Stimmt habs gerade probiert, passiert aber nur wenn man vorher einen Eintrag in der Listbox auswählt. Das dürfte wohl ein Fehler in der vorgegebene listbox.selectall; sein. Naja danke für den Tipp, werds auf jeden Fall fixen.

zu 2.: auch danke für diesen Punkt, habe eigentlich geglaubt, dass ich diesen Fall bereits abgefangen hatte, aber es fehlten doch ein paar Zeilen Code..
  Mit Zitat antworten Zitat
Benutzerbild von Cyberbob
Cyberbob

 
Delphi XE7 Architect
 
#38
  Alt 24. Okt 2005, 13:25
Wenn Einträge gelöscht werden, sind diese zwar aus der Liste verschwunden, bei einem Neustart oder wechsel des registers stehen diese allerdings wieder in der Liste.
Dateien, mit einem @ oder einem € im Dateinamen oder Pfad werden nicht richtig behandelt.
Christian
  Mit Zitat antworten Zitat
kurtm1
 
#39
  Alt 24. Okt 2005, 13:31
Zitat von Cyberbob:
Wenn Einträge gelöscht werden, sind diese zwar aus der Liste verschwunden, bei einem Neustart oder wechsel des registers stehen diese allerdings wieder in der Liste.
Dateien, mit einem @ oder einem € im Dateinamen oder Pfad werden nicht richtig behandelt.
Aufs erste bin ich gestern auch draufgekommen, da habe ich eine Zeile Code vergessen

Und zum 2.: Das ist klar, weil ich diese Zeichen als Steuerzeichen verwende, das werde ich aber so lassen, weil ich nicht davon ausgehem dass in einem Dateinamen diese Zeichen vorkommen



//EDIT: Hier mal eine neue Version der Lib, jetzt sollten wirklich alle Fehler draußen sein
//EDIT2: Jetzt auch mit Screenshot
Miniaturansicht angehängter Grafiken
medialibrary_880.gif  
Angehängte Dateien
Dateityp: zip medialibrary_898.zip (228,2 KB, 20x aufgerufen)
  Mit Zitat antworten Zitat
kurtm1
 
#40
  Alt 14. Dez 2005, 12:34
so letzter Aufruf *gg*

Habe jetzt dann endlich wieder Zeit zum Coden, daher gehts jetzt dann voll los. Gibts vielleicht doch jemanden der daran interessiert ist, auf irgendeine Weise (Coden, Design, ...) mitzuhelfen?
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 4 von 4   « Erste     234   


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 18:17 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z